Mock测试就是在测试的时候,虚拟一个测试的对象,来对某些未完成或者不易获取的接口提早进行测试的方法。
要作到并不难,只须要到好合适的Mock工具,定义好接口文档就能够开始互不影响的同时开始工做,只须要最后联调或者有接口耦合的时候对接一下就能够,不用出现一个团队等待另外一个团队的状况。
这样的话,开发自测阶段就能够更早开始,能够提早更多时间发现缺陷,对产品的质量以及进度的保证都能带来更高的收益。工具
如何使用Eolinker进行Mock API开发?
Eolinker是一个国产的企业级接口管理开发工具,能够直接在平台上完成整个API生命周期的开发,也支持Mock开发和对接其余工具。
在Eolinker中,Mock功能是利用可视化界面简化了写脚本的流程,只要填写触发条件就能够自动生成响应结果,也能够本身填写响应结果的数据格式。
触发条件支持请求头部、请求体(Form-data、JSON)、Query 参数等。
如下例子表示当 Form-data 参数中包含 user_name = jackliu 时,返回静态的字符串数据:
开发工具
完成后只须要在界面上复制Mock地址,就能够在代码中直接对该API地址发起请求便可获得响应结果。
测试
在Eolinker的帮助文档里也能够找到相关的内容,有兴趣的不妨也试用一下。
使用地址:www.eolinker.comorm